- [ ] Plugin authors: confirm all vendored fonts ship under the Thornquill redistribution terms before submitting to the Lanternworks gallery. Include the license text in fonts/NOTICES, strip unused weights to keep bundles under the 4 MB cap, and verify rendering in both the Emberline and Coldharbor themes. Subsetting must be deterministic so review diffs stay clean. Validation was performed against the build referenced below.

trace token, bagag-fahag: htk21_1a5003b533f7b0cca4331

If your plugin loses its trace-context account, stop emitting spans immediately. Orphaned spans break correlation across the Lattice mesh and pollute downstream sampling. File a recovery request through the plugin console; approval is automatic if your last rotation was under 30 days ago. Once approved, re-fetch the span-signing credentials and resume emission. The broker will prompt for the shared recovery passphrase before releasing credentials. It is recorded below for authorized responders.

unlock words, kawig-bawef: belax-sorir-druax-ulaiel-wenael-belael

## Spoolhouse Onboarding

Welcome! Spoolhouse is our little printer-spooler microservice — it queues print jobs from the Inkbarrel front end and talks to floor printers at the Hollowbrook office. Most support tickets are just stuck queues; hit the flush endpoint and you're done. To call that endpoint from your terminal, use the key below.

gateway credential: kto23_LX9A4ys6i4nzHtpOLNLodKK

**Action item (owner: Priya, due next sync):** Our webhook delivery in Ferngate retries blindly — no backoff, no idempotency keys — which is how we double-charged the demo tenants last Tuesday. Priya will draft new retry semantics: exponential backoff, capped attempts, dedupe tokens. Please skim her proposal before Thursday so we can actually decide something. The draft lives on the internal page below:

operations page: https://confluence.qorvellabs.internal/pages/projects/projects/projects